Hiring a plumber is important when a plumbing job is more than you can handle. Unfortunately, many homeowners have a DIY attitude and mistakenly believe they can handle a plumbing project, when they are truly ill-prepared. To avoid getting in over your head with a plumbing nightmare, make sure you follow these tips, so you will know when to call a Plumber in Easton.

* If you turn your faucets on and hear a screeching noise, you have air in your line. You should not worry if this happens only occasionally or is occurring after your water was shut down for some time. If the problem continues, you need to have a plumber come out and check your bleed switch. It could have gone bad and is allowing too much air in your lines. This can lead to blockages and can decrease your water pressure. This job is best left to a professional.

* If your hot water pressure seems to have dropped, the hot water is rusty or the water runs out quickly, your hot water tank is to blame. If you are not trained in working on hot water heaters or installing them, you need to call a Plumber in Easton. Hot water heaters need to be precisely installed, to avoid the risk of electrical shock. Make sure you leave this job to the pros and stay safe.

* Frozen pipes may not seem like a huge deal, but they can be. Massive damage can occur to your pipes and cause leaks all in your home. If your pipes have frozen, you need to get a plumber out immediately. The plumber will assess the condition of your pipes and replace any damaged ones, so you do not have water leaks.

There are many others reasons you might consider calling a plumber instead of trying to take care of the job yourself.
